#40b114 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#40b114 is composed of 25.1% red, 69.4%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 88.7%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 103.2 degrees, a saturation of 79.7% and a lightness of 38.6%. #40b114 color hex could be obtained by blending #80ff28 with #006300.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

Shades and Tints of #40b114
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#f2fdee is the lightest one.

Tones of #40b114
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#616560 is the less saturated color, while #39c005 is the most saturated one.
